Exploring Ballestas Islands

Full Day Tour in Lima Paracas Ica - Exploring Ballestas Islands

One of the highlights of the full-day tour is the modern boat tour to the Ballestas Islands. Passengers will board sliders, or small boats, for a cruise around this wildlife-rich area.

They’ll have the chance to spot colonies of sea lions, pelicans, and Humboldt penguins along the rocky coastline. The boat tour also provides views of the mysterious Candelabra geoglyph carved into the hillside.

Guides will share information about the unique ecosystem and wildlife as travelers observe the bustling activity of the islands. This is an excellent opportunity to witness Peru’s diverse marine life in its natural habitat.

Discovering Huacachina Oasis

Full Day Tour in Lima Paracas Ica - Discovering Huacachina Oasis

After exploring the artisan winery, the tour continues on to the breathtaking Huacachina Oasis.

This desert lagoon, surrounded by towering sand dunes, is one of Peru’s most unique natural attractions.

The tour includes:

  1. An exhilarating dune buggy ride through the surrounding desert landscapes.
  2. The opportunity to try sandboarding, gliding down the steep dunes on a specialized board.
  3. Time to wander the oasis, admiring the palm trees and vibrant blue waters.
  4. The chance to capture stunning panoramic views from the top of the dunes.

This experience offers a thrilling taste of Peruvian desert adventure and the chance to discover the hidden gem of Huacachina.

What Should I Pack for the Desert Activities?

For the desert activities, bring sun protection like hats, sunglasses, and sunscreen. Wear lightweight, breathable clothing and closed-toe shoes. Pack a small backpack or waist pack to carry essentials like water, snacks, and camera. Don’t forget to bring a bandana or scarf to protect from dust.
